首页 > 其他分享 >淘宝订单AP I淘宝订单数据接口 获取商品订单列表 获取商品订单详情

淘宝订单AP I淘宝订单数据接口 获取商品订单列表 获取商品订单详情

时间:2024-03-09 14:33:18浏览次数:34  
标签:获取 接口 开放平台 订单 API 淘宝

淘宝订单API是淘宝开放平台提供的一组接口,允许开发者获取淘宝或天猫的订单数据,包括订单列表和订单详情。要使用这些API,你需要遵循一定的步骤来获取并接入这些接口。

以下是获取淘宝订单数据的基本步骤:

  1. 注册并创建应用
    首先,你需要在淘宝开放平台注册账号,并创建一个应用。创建应用时,你需要填写应用的基本信息,并设置应用的回调地址。

  2. 申请API权限
    在应用中,你需要申请订单相关的API权限。这些权限包括获取订单列表、获取订单详情等。申请权限后,淘宝开放平台会进行审核,审核通过后才能使用这些API。

  3. 获取API文档和SDK
    审核通过后,你可以访问淘宝开放平台的官方文档,下载SDK(如果提供的话),并阅读API的使用说明、请求参数、返回结果等信息。

  4. 调用API获取订单数据
    使用你的App Key和App Secret,根据API文档的指导,构建HTTP请求调用相应的API接口。
    请求参数:api=

参数说明:其它参数:参考淘宝开放平台接口文档,与淘宝的参数一致 https://open.taobao.com/api.htm?docId=140&docType=2

名称 类型 必须 描述
api String 淘宝开放平台的接口名(如:taobao.picture.upload( 上传单张图片 ))
session String 授权换取的session_id
[其他参数] String 其它参数:参考淘宝开放平台接口文档,与淘宝的参数一致

获取订单列表
通常,你可以通过调用“订单列表查询”API来获取某个时间段内的订单列表。你需要提供必要的请求参数,如开始时间、结束时间、买家昵称等。

获取订单详情
对于特定的订单,你可以调用“订单详情查询”API来获取该订单的详细信息,包括订单状态、商品信息、收货地址等。

  1. 处理API响应
    接收API返回的响应数据,解析这些数据,提取出你需要的订单信息。

  2. 错误处理与日志记录
    在调用API的过程中,可能会遇到各种错误或异常情况。你需要设计合理的错误处理机制,记录错误信息,以便后续排查问题。

  3. 遵守平台规则与限制
    使用API时,务必遵守淘宝开放平台的规则与限制,不得滥用API或进行任何违规操作。

注意事项
API接口和参数可能会随着淘宝或天猫平台的更新而有所变化,因此建议定期查看官方文档以获取最新信息。
对于涉及用户隐私的订单数据,务必确保数据的安全性和隐私保护。
在处理订单数据时,要考虑到并发和性能的问题,确保应用的稳定性和响应速度。
总之,通过遵循以上步骤和注意事项,你可以成功接入淘宝订单API,并获取所需的商品订单列表和订单详情数据。

标签:获取,接口,开放平台,订单,API,淘宝
From: https://www.cnblogs.com/Mike-847337137/p/18062673

相关文章

  • 淘宝天猫获得商品详情 API 如何做到实时数据获取?
    淘宝天猫的商品详情API实现实时数据获取主要依赖于以下几个关键方面:API设计与更新频率:淘宝天猫的API接口会定期进行数据更新,确保返回的商品详情是最新的。这通常依赖于平台的后端系统,它们会实时监控商品数据的变化并实时更新到API中。开发者在调用API时,可以获取到最新的商品详......
  • ros|TF工具获取IMU数据
    voidIMUCallback(sensor_msgs::Imumsg){if(msg.orientation_covariance[0]<0)//若协方差矩阵第一个值为-1,表示数据不存在return;//用TF工具将四元数转化为欧拉角tf::Quaternionquaternion(msg.orientation.x,msg.orientation.y,ms......
  • API 的安全性(淘宝商品详情店铺)
    API的安全性在淘宝商品详情店铺的上下文中是一个至关重要的考虑因素。淘宝开放平台提供了丰富的API接口,包括商品、店铺、交易、评价、物流等多个模块,这些接口为开发者提供了获取和操作数据的便利,但同时也带来了安全风险。以下是一些关于API安全性的关键要素,以及在淘宝商品详情店......
  • 在Html界面上显示当前時間 , 使用js获取.
    为什么现在不能展开显示代码,只能折叠了,用行内代码把code贴上也显示不出来.点击查看代码<spanid="timenow"style="float:left;"></span><script>setInterval(functiongetNowTime(){varnowTime=newDate();varnowYear=nowTime.......
  • [GPT] quasar 在 setup() 周期阶段想设置meta信息,如何获取当前的 route 参数动态设置
     在Vue3的CompositionAPI(组合式API)中,特别是在 setup() 钩子函数阶段,由于没有访问到常规的Vue实例(this上下文),所以不能直接使用 this.$route 来获取路由信息。但是,你可以通过 useRoute() 函数来访问当前活跃的路由对象: import{useRoute}from'vue-router';......
  • Python中Spark读取parquet文件并获取schema的JSON表示
     步骤:初始化SparkSession。使用spark.read.parquet()读取Parquet文件。调用df.schema.json()获取schema的JSON表示。frompyspark.sqlimportSparkSession#初始化SparkSessionspark=SparkSession.builder.appName("ReadParquetSchema").getOrCreate(......
  • 电商API接口入门指南 (淘宝商品详情店铺)
    电商API接口入门指南旨在为初学者提供关于电商API接口的基本知识和使用方法的指导。以下是一个简要的入门指南,帮助你开始使用电商API接口。一、了解API接口的基本概念首先,你需要了解API接口的基本概念。API(ApplicationProgrammingInterface,应用程序编程接口)是不同软件应用程序......
  • 淘宝详情api接口的应用
    淘宝详情API接口是一个基于HTTP协议的接口服务,可用于获取淘宝商品的具体信息。下面将介绍如何调用淘宝详情API接口获取淘宝商品数据的步骤。1.注册账号并创建应用首先,我们需要进行账号注册、实名认证和创建应用。通过创建应用,我们可以获取到一个appkey和appsecret,这是调用API接......
  • 获取前几个月的月份
    letcurrentDate=newDate(); //获取当前日期   letcurrentMonth=currentDate.getMonth(); //获取当前月份(从0开始)   letcurrentYear=currentDate.getFullYear(); //获取当前年份   letresult=[];   for(leti=0;i<4;i++......
  • R语言质量控制图、质量管理研究分析采购订单数量、CPU时间、纸厂产出、钢板数据可视化
    全文链接:https://tecdat.cn/?p=35288原文出处:拓端数据部落公众号在当今信息时代,数据的收集和分析变得至关重要,特别是在质量管理和生产过程控制方面。控制图作为一种统计工具,广泛应用于监控过程变化、识别异常和改进生产效率。本文针对SAS启动时间、纸厂产出、钢板、采购订单数量......